#d19704 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d19704 is composed of 82% red, 59.2%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 27.8% magenta, 98.1%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 43 degrees, a saturation of 96.2% and a lightness of 41.8%. #d19704 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ff08 with #a32f00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

● #d19704 color description : Strong orange.
#d19704 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d19704 has RGB values of R:209, G:151,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.28, Y:0.98,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13735684.

Shades and Tints of #d19704
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110c00 is the darkest color, while #fffefc is the lightest one.
